Default Opinions?? - Help With Selecting Receiver


I have a Kenwood KV 4080 that is starting to act up. I'm looking at
replacing it with a Sony STR-DE995. I want something with AV inputs
that will be compatible with equipment for the next 4-5 years, and
something with a decent sound level (although I'm not a "loud rock"
person).

I've seen the STR-DE995 for $350 shipped to my door. So that looks
like a decent price range.

While looking at the Sony I've been steered to two other units, all
with about the same features and within $50 of the Sony.

-- Sony STR-DE995
-- Denon AVR 1804
-- Onkyo TSXR601

Can anyone tell me about the receivers and/or offer opinions &
experiences?

I do warranty service for all 3 and I would rate the product thusly:

1. Denon
2. Sony
3. Onkyo

But as you say, not too much too separate them.

I would rate support a bit different:

1. Onkyo
2. Sony
